A Promising Tool for Predicting Consciousness Evolution in Prolonged Disorders of Consciousness
Phase 2
Completed
36 enrolled
Xijing Hospital
Guangzhou University of Chinese Medicine · collabTianjin University · collabUniversity of Melbourne · collab
Non-randomizedParallel-groupSingle-blindScreening
Summary
The research contains two parts. Part 1: To explore whether EEG responses to zolpidem can assess consciousness circuit integrity and predict the evolution of consciousness in patients with prolonged disorders of consciousness; Part 2: To explore if quantitative EEG reactivity might predict the prognosis of disorders of consciousness.
